Heller-Heller-Gorfine tests are a set of powerful statistical tests of multivariate k-sample homogeneity and independence (Heller et. al., 2013, <doi:10.1093/biomet/ass070>). For the univariate case, the package also offers implementations of the 'MinP DDP' and 'MinP ADP' tests by Heller et. al. (2016), which are consistent against all continuous alternatives but are distribution-free, and are thus much faster to apply.
